A company manufactures and sells novelty mugs. The manufacturing costs consists of a fixed cost of R8000 AND A VARIABLE COST OF R15.00 per mug. The mugs are sold at R35 each. Assume a linear profit function.1. Determine the profit function.
2. What is the break-even level.
3. Draw a graph depicting a profit function.

Answers

Given:
Manufacturing cost : fixed cost = 8,000 ; variable cost = 15 per mug
Selling Price: 35 per mug

Let x be the number of mugs.

Sales Revenue = 35x
Manufacturing Cost = 8,000 + 15x

Profit = Sales Revenue - Manufacturing Cost
P = 35x - 8,000 - 15x
P = 20x - 8,000

Break even level: Profit is 0
Sales Revenue = Manufacturing cost
35x = 8,000 + 15x
35x - 15x = 8000
20x = 8000
x = 8000/20
x = 400

Company must produce at least 400 mugs to break even or have 0 profit. Quantity greater than 400 will result to a profit while quantity lesser than 400 will result to a loss.

A company sells widgets. The amount of profit, y, made by the company, is related to the selling price of each widget, x, by the given equation. Using this equation, find out the maximum amount of profit the company can make, to the nearest dollar. y=−5x^2+263x−1844

Answers

Answer: The maximum amount of profit the company can make is $1604.

Step-by-step explanation:

To find the maximum amount of profit the company can make, we need to determine the vertex of the quadratic equation y = -5x^2 + 263x - 1844. The x-coordinate of the vertex represents the selling price that will yield the maximum profit, and the y-coordinate represents the maximum profit itself.

The x-coordinate of the vertex can be found using the formula: x = -b / (2a), where a, b, and c are the coefficients of the quadratic equation in the form ax^2 + bx + c.

In this case, a = -5 and b = 263. Let's substitute these values into the formula:

x = -263 / (2 * -5)

Now, let's simplify the expression:

x = -263 / -10

x = 26.3

To find the maximum profit, we substitute the x-coordinate of the vertex into the equation:

y = -5(26.3)^2 + 263(26.3) - 1844

Now, perform the calculations:

y = -5(691.69) + 6906.9 - 1844

y = -3458.45 + 6906.9 - 1844

y = 1604.45

Therefore, to the nearest dollar, the maximum amount of profit the company can make is $1604.
